en.Wedoany.com Reported - On July 16, the Piraeus Port Authority S.A. signed a memorandum of understanding with the National Technical University of Athens to strengthen cooperation in research, innovation, and sustainable port development at Greece's largest port.
The memorandum establishes a framework for joint research projects, educational programs, and knowledge sharing between the port operator and this top Greek engineering institution. The two parties will focus on research in areas such as smart port technologies, digital transformation, environmental sustainability, maritime safety, and logistics.
As the port industry faces increasing pressure to enhance efficiency while reducing environmental impact, collaboration between industry and academia is becoming increasingly common. This partnership aims to combine scientific research with operational experience to develop practical solutions for real-world port challenges.
Han Chao, Chairman of the Piraeus Port Authority, stated that the memorandum strengthens the link between academia and the port industry by integrating the university's scientific expertise with the company's operational knowledge, creating favorable conditions for developing advanced solutions and supporting the sustainable development of the Port of Piraeus. The National Technical University of Athens noted that its long-established research capabilities will help meet the evolving needs of the port and the broader Greek economy.
As a subsidiary of COSCO SHIPPING Group, the Piraeus Port Authority continues to seek strategic partnerships to drive port modernization, enhance competitiveness, and promote sustainable growth. This collaboration is expected to provide a platform for long-term research, technology development, and education, benefiting the port, the Greek maritime sector, and future maritime professionals.
